Tailoring Smart Patrol Vehicles: The ODM Customization Advantage

No two cities share identical topographical layouts or security challenges. For instance, European cities feature narrow, historical lanes requiring compact, high-maneuverability form factors, whereas North American municipal parks and open university campuses demand high-power traction for gravel paths and hilly terrains.

Our ODM manufacturing workflow is structured around modular vehicle design, enabling swift adjustments across several critical build specifications:

  • Integrated Public Address and Siren Modules: Custom brackets for megaphones, flashing warning lights (red/blue/amber), and pre-wired multi-tone sirens connected to the primary vehicle battery through step-down converters.
  • Digital Telemetry & Smart Dashcams: Real-time GPS mapping, dual-lens DVR cameras with night vision, and seamless 4G/5G data routing to central command hubs.
  • Reinforced Chassis and Cargo Configurations: High-carbon steel frames engineered with structural anti-corrosion marine-grade paints, paired with heavy-duty cargo boxes, medical gear holders, or specialized fire-extinguisher racks.
  • Ergonomic Comfort Systems: Heavy-duty shock absorption, backrest configurations, and all-weather seating options for prolonged continuous patrol shifts.

Technical Roadmap & Engineering Specifications

Developing reliable, export-ready patrol vehicles requires rigorous attention to electrical engineering and structural design. Standard consumer micro-mobility scooters fail under the structural stress of continuous 12-hour commercial patrol cycles. The technical architecture developed by Aurora Electric Vehicle addresses these issues directly.

Technical Parameter Standard Commuter E-Bike Aurora Smart Patrol Electric Vehicle (ODM Spec)
Frame Construction Standard Aluminum Alloy / Mild Steel Reinforced High-Carbon Tensile Steel (Robotically Welded)
Powertrain Motor 250W - 350W Hub Motor 500W - 1500W High-Torque Hub Motor (IP67 Waterproof)
Battery Management Standard Lithium BMS Smart CAN-bus BMS with Thermal Runaway Protection
Suspension System Front Spring Forks Only Dual-Hydraulic Heavy-Duty Suspension (Front & Rear)
Braking Architecture Mechanical Disc / V-Brakes Front & Rear Ventilated Hydraulic Disc Brakes (ABS Option)
Lighting & Signaling Low-lumen LED Headlight 360-degree LED Patrol Lightbars, Sirens, High-Output Strobe Units
Logistics Box/Storage Soft Baskets / Optional Rack Lockable All-Weather ABS Cargo Trunk with Custom Mounts

Modular Power & Thermal Protection

Our battery arrays feature Samsung or LG high-capacity cylindrical cells. Managed by a custom CAN-bus Smart BMS, the system actively monitors state-of-charge, cell balance, and thermal fluctuations, protecting against short-circuits and over-temperature occurrences.

Smart IoT Integration & Fleet Management

Equipped with GPS tracking and GSM cellular modules, our vehicles allow central command rooms to track patrol fleets in real time. Virtual geofencing triggers alert notifications if a patrol officer exits their assigned beats or zones.

Company History, Dedicated R&D and Organizational Culture

Founded in 2015, Aurora Electric Vehicle Shandong Co., Ltd. has developed from a local assembly workshop into a comprehensive enterprise integrating R&D, manufacturing, international sales, and dedicated after-sales support.

During the 2019 implementation of China's New National Standards for electric bicycles, our R&D division restructured our product blueprints to exceed mandatory safety guidelines, including fire retardant elements, speed limit configurations, and anti-tampering electronics. Our core development team features senior engineers with over ten years of industry experience, holding patents in battery thermal management and electric motor efficiency.

Frequently Asked Questions (FAQ)

What options are available for ODM municipal patrol customizations?
Our ODM platform supports structural additions, including mounting brackets for siren bars, integrated public address megaphones, flashing warning strobes, rear-mounted all-weather gear cases, high-definition dashcams, and built-in GPS telemetry units. Custom frame colors, fleet numbering, and department badges can also be applied during manufacturing.
How does the factory ensure lithium battery safety?
We use premium battery chemistry managed by a smart CAN-bus BMS. Every battery pack undergoes automated cycles of overcharge protection testing, vibration testing, and thermal evaluations to prevent issues under hot climates or intensive shift structures.
What is the standard production and shipping lead time from Linyi?
Our standard production cycle for container-load wholesale orders ranges from 25 to 35 days, depending on customization options. Leveraging Linyi's transportation network, we route goods to Qingdao Port within 24 hours, ensuring reliable dispatch and delivery schedules.
Do your patrol vehicles meet European and North American regulations?
Yes, our vehicle designs are compliant with international standards, holding CE, FCC, and RoHS certificates. We work with our partners to ensure the configurations meet local speed limits, motor output limits, and road-legal certification categories.
